Hard Drives are devices used to store and retrieve digital data. They are essential for saving your files, applications, and operating system. When choosing a hard drive, consider storage capacity, speed, and type (HDD or SSD) to ensure it meets your needs.
Hard Drives are traditional storage devices with spinning disks, while SSDs use flash memory for faster performance. SSDs offer quicker data access and durability but are usually more expensive than Hard Drives. Consider your budget and speed requirements when choosing between them.
The size of Hard Drive you need depends on your storage requirements. A 500GB Hard Drive might suffice for basic use, while 1TB or more is better for storing large files like videos. Assess how much data you plan to store before deciding.
External Hard Drives are portable storage solutions that connect via USB or other interfaces. Choose an external Hard Drive if you need mobility or extra storage without internal upgrades.
Hard Drives' performance is influenced by speed (RPM), cache size, and interface type (e.g., SATA). Higher RPMs offer faster data access, while a larger cache improves data handling efficiency. Evaluate these features to ensure optimal performance for your tasks.
Hard Drives typically last between 3 to 5 years with regular use. However, lifespan can vary based on usage patterns and environmental factors. Regular backups and monitoring health can help prolong their life and protect your data.
